What should I know about CPA Goal?

  • CPA goal is what you want to spend to earn one conversion. Put the value in and Fire & Forget takes care of the rest.
  • Fire & Forget will look to see if you have 3 conversions so far today in order to optimize on the site level. Fire & Forget also looks at 5 conversions today to optimize on the campaign level.
  • CPA Goal will only optimize if the following conditions are met -
    • Site Level: If a minimum of 3 conversions have happened Today. This means that any sites which have more than 3 conversions will be optimizing with their own site data
    • Campaign Level: If a minimum of 5 conversions have happened Today. Sites that don't have 3 conversions will be using their site bid modifier (if it is a Taboola, Outbrain, or Gemini campaign) multiplied with the campaign CPC that is changed by CPA Goals. All sites without bids are bidding at the campaign level, so along with the campaign CPA goal bid. Click here to learn more about site bidding.

Starter Plan Settings



CPA Goal

How much you want to spend per conversion. If your conversion payout is $30 and you feel comfortable spending $20 per conversion, $20 would be your CPA Goal. Keep in mind that CPA Goal works with Today's data and needs a certain number of conversions to begin optimizing CPC with Today's data.

Lowest Bid

The lowest bid CPA Goal will use. Slow Amount sets the bid to this lowest bid value when your campaign has lost the slow amount today.

Highest Bid

The highest CPC bid CPA Goal will use.

​Slow Amount

If you want your campaign to slow down when it has lost x amount of dollars today - use this value.

Stop Amount

If your campaign has lost this much money today, pause the campaign for the rest of the day.

Protect Profit Slow

If your campaign has gained this much profit today, slow the bidding down to decrease spend.

Protect Profit Stop

If your campaign has gained this much profit today, pause the campaign for the rest of the day.




Pro Plan Settings



CPA Goal

How much you want to spend per conversion. If your conversion payout is $30 and you feel comfortable spending $20 per conversion, this would be your CPA Goal. Keep in mind that CPA Goal works with Today's data and needs a certain number of conversions to begin optimizing CPC with Today's data.

Budget Reset

Every morning at 1:30am your budget will get reset to this amount. This lets you safely scale and start over with a new budget the next day.

Lowest Bid

The lowest bid CPA Goal will use, and also the lowest bid Desired Click Pacing will use. Slow Amount sets the bid to this lowest bid value when your campaign has lost the slow amount today.

Highest Bid

The highest CPC bid CPA Goal will use, and also the highest bid Desired Click Pacing will use.

Slow Amount

If you want your campaign to slow down when it has lost x amount of dollars today - use this value.

Stop Amount

If your campaign has lost this much money today, pause the campaign for the rest of the day.

Sample Size

How many clicks have you seen so far today that you think you need to let Maximus start driving traffic with Desired Click Pacing.

Desired Click Pacing

If your campaign has had the Sample Size clicks already today, Fire and Forget can increase your CPC to drive traffic. It will increase campaign CPC by 10% repeatedly until it starts seeing that number of clicks in the time period you set.

Protect Profit Slow

If your campaign has gained this much profit today, slow the bidding down to decrease spend.

Protect Profit Stop

If your campaign has gained this much profit today, pause the campaign for the rest of the day.



Day Parting

Day Parting is a feature that lets you pause your campaign or set it to a specific CPC for a time period throughout the day.

Day Parting is a feature of Fire & Forget, which means that it only works when Fire & Forget is enabled. You can use it to slow bidding during off hours, or even stop your campaign entirely - these depend on how your campaigns perform and any restrictions they may have.

Starter Plan accounts do not have the Restore CPC feature available.
